I know others have had different experiences, but I can honestly say my stay here was great. I arrived much earlier than the checkout time to leave luggage and they checked me in early, which was appreciated. The room was also very comfortable and clean - very effective air conditioning so it was nice and cool. It's fair to say the area around the outside of the hotel is not exactly pleasant but it's a stone's throw from the main station and you don't have to walk long through the dodgy streets to get there. I'd reccomend to anyone wanting to stay near the station so they can catch an early morning train or flight.

Disappointing Experience – Would Not Recommend I had a very disappointing stay, mainly due to the hotel’s surrounding neighborhood. As a woman traveling alone, I felt unsafe—there were people openly using drugs and injecting themselves right near the hotel entrance, which was extremely unsettling. I had to book something quickly due to a flight cancellation, and unfortunately, this hotel turned out to be a poor choice. What surprised me most is that the hotel has a rating of 8 on Booking.com. I honestly don’t know how it earned that score. After my experience, I checked the reviews on Google, and they painted a much more accurate and concerning picture. The hotel itself felt far from a 4-star standard. The room had a strong, unpleasant odor, the carpets were stained, the towels smelled bad, and the room was incredibly hot. It felt like a sauna, and to make matters worse, the air conditioning was broken. One of the lamps was also not working. Breakfast was well below average—not at all what you'd expect for the price or the star rating. The only redeeming factor was the staff, who were somewhat friendly. But unfortunately, that alone couldn’t make up for the overall poor experience.
